Excel转PDF时一页变两页?原因分析与高效解决方案

问题:Excel转PDF时,为何内容会“自动分页”?

许多用户在将Excel工作表转换为PDF文件时,都遇到过这样的困扰:明明在Excel中查看时,所有内容都整齐地排布在一页上,但转换成PDF后,却莫名多出一页,导致内容断开或排版混乱。这不仅影响了文档的专业性和可读性,也常常导致打印时的浪费。

核心原因分析

这种现象并非软件故障,而是由以下几个关键设置决定的:

  • 打印区域设置不当:Excel的PDF转换功能在底层逻辑上与“打印”操作紧密相关。如果设置了超出默认页面大小的打印区域,系统会自动分页。
  • 缩放比例设置:在“页面布局”或“打印”设置中,如果“缩放以适合”选项未被设置为“将所有列/行调整为一页”,或者手动设置的缩放比例(如90%)仍不足以容纳所有内容。
  • 分页符被插入或调整:用户可能无意中插入了手动分页符,或者Excel根据默认设置自动生成了分页符。
  • 页面方向(纵向/横向)与纸张大小不匹配:宽表格在纵向A4纸上自然需要更多页数。

高效解决方案:确保“一页即一页”

遵循以下步骤,可以精准控制PDF的页数:

方法一:调整“页面布局”设置(治本之策)

  1. 在Excel中,点击顶部菜单栏的 “页面布局” 选项卡。
  2. 调整纸张方向:根据表格宽度,在“纸张方向”中选择“横向”。
  3. 调整页边距:点击“页边距”,选择“窄”或自定义更小的页边距,以最大化内容区域。
  4. 设置缩放比例:这是最关键的一步。找到 “调整为合适大小” 组,将“宽度”和“高度”都设置为 “1 页”。这将强制所有列和行压缩在一页内。

方法二:利用“打印预览”进行最终确认

  1. 点击 “文件” > “打印”(或使用快捷键 Ctrl+P)。
  2. 在右侧的打印预览窗格中,您会看到最终的分页效果。底部状态栏会显示“共 1 页”。
  3. 如果这里显示多页,请回到“页面布局”重新调整缩放比例或边距。
  4. 确认为1页后,点击打印预览窗格中的打印机下拉菜单,选择 “Microsoft Print to PDF” 或其他PDF虚拟打印机,然后点击“打印”即可生成PDF。

方法三:手动删除或调整分页符

  1. 在“视图”选项卡中,切换到 “分页预览” 模式。此时,蓝色虚线代表自动分页,实线代表手动分页。
  2. 您可以拖动蓝色分页线来调整分页位置,或者右键点击分页线并选择“重置所有分页符”。

方法四:选择专业的转换工具

如果Excel内置的转换功能仍不理想,可以考虑使用专业的PDF转换软件(如Adobe Acrobat、WPS Office的PDF工具等)。这些工具通常提供更精细的排版控制和转换选项,能更好地保持格式的一致性。

预防措施与最佳实践

  • 设计时就考虑输出格式:在制作Excel表格时,尽量使用合理的列宽和字体大小,并预先考虑其PDF输出效果。
  • 优先使用横向布局:对于列数较多的表格,从一开始就设置页面为“横向”。
  • 养成打印预览习惯:在转换或打印前,务必通过“打印预览”查看最终效果,这是避免意外的最可靠方法。

总结

解决Excel转PDF一页变两页的问题,核心在于理解其背后的“打印逻辑”,并主动控制“页面布局”中的缩放、页边距和方向。通过以上方法,您可以轻松确保转换后的PDF文档页数符合预期,保持专业整洁的排版,从而提升工作效率和文档质量。